Prevalent Tire Issues: What to Look For
Many drivers encounter standard tire issues that can greatly influence vehicle performance and protection. One prevalent issue is uneven deterioration, which can result from improper alignment or tire inflation. This condition not only shortens the lifespan of tires but can also lead to compromised traction. Another significant problem is low tire pressure, often caused by temperature changes or gradual leaks. Inadequate pressure increases rolling resistance, impairing fuel efficiency and maneuverability. Additionally, operators should be alert for sidewall damage, such as cuts or bulges, which can undermine the tire's structural soundness. Tread depth is also essential; worn tires can significantly reduce grip, especially in wet conditions. Finally, vibrations while driving can suggest interior tire problems, potentially leading to failure. Identifying these standard tire complications helps encourage safer driving and peak vehicle performance. Regular inspections and maintenance are crucial to address these concerns effectively.

When to Fix or Get New Your Tires: Key Information You Must Know About Your Tires?
Recognizing when to repair or replace tires is vital for ensuring automobile safety and efficiency. Usually, if a tire has a puncture less than a quarter-inch in circumference and is situated in the tread area, it can be repaired. Still, sidewall damage or tears larger than this often call for replacement.
Additionally, tread wear serves as a significant factor in this choice. Tires should be replaced when tread depth falls below the suggested standard, usually around 2/32 of an inch. Irregular wear marks may also suggest underlying issues, such as alignment issues, which could necessitate replacement rather than repair.
Furthermore, age represents an essential component; tires beyond six years old should undergo close inspection, because rubber weakens as time progresses. In conclusion, consulting a tire service expert can help vehicle owners with making sound choices, promoting safety and maximum performance on the road.

Tracking Tire Pressure
Maintaining accurate tire pressure is critical for optimal vehicle performance and safety, especially as seasons shift. Temperature changes can greatly influence tire pressure, resulting in under-inflation or over-inflation. Consistent monitoring assists drivers in maintaining the recommended pressure levels, boosting fuel efficiency and assuring top traction. Drivers should ensure their tire pressure at least once every month and before extended trips. Employing a trustworthy pressure gauge can provide accurate readings. Additionally, numerous modern vehicles are fitted with Tire Pressure Monitoring Systems (TPMS) that alert drivers to significant pressure shifts. Being aware of tire pressure not only extends the lifespan of tires but also lowers the risk of blowouts, promoting overall road safety during seasonal transitions. Tread Depth Inspection
Consistently checking tire tread depth is critical for maintaining vehicle safety and performance, especially as driving conditions change with the seasons. Tread depth directly affects traction, braking distance, and overall handling, making it crucial for safe driving. A simple method to assess tread depth is the penny test: inserting a penny into the tread with Lincoln's head down; if the head is visible, the tread is too worn. Experts recommend a minimum tread depth of 2/32 of an inch for safe driving. Seasonal checks are vital, as winter conditions demand deeper treads for improved grip. Maintaining adequate tread depth not only enhances safety but also boosts fuel efficiency, ultimately leading to cost savings over time. Regular inspections help prevent premature tire replacement.

How Many Times Ought I Spin My Tires?
Tires should typically be rotated every 5,000 to 7,500 miles, or as recommended by the vehicle manufacturer. Routine rotation helps ensure even wear, prolonging tire life and enhancing vehicle efficiency and protection on the road.
What Is the Ideal Tire Pressure for My Vehicle?
Most vehicles require an ideal tire PSI that typically ranges between 30 to 35 PSI. However, it's necessary to confirm the maker's specifications, usually found on the driver's side door jamb or in the owner's manual.
Is it Feasible to Drive on a Punctured Tire Temporarily?
Driving on a deflated tire for a short time is not recommended. It can cause wheel damage and compromise security. Quick intervention is suggested; changing the tire or using a spare guarantees better performance and safety on the road.
How do I identify if my tires have worn out?
To assess if tires are depleted, one should check for tire depth using the penny test, observe visible cracks or bulges, and observe irregular wear, indicating that potential replacement is necessary.
What Represent the Signals of Uneven Tire Wear?
Signs of uneven tire wear consist of irregular tread patterns, excessive wear on one side, visible cupping or scalloping, vibrations while driving, and reduced handling capability. Routine checks can help detect these problems ahead of time.
